We are searching for the best talent for an Associate Director in Oncology Discovery Innovative Medicine located in Beerse Belgium.

Purpose: Join our Oncology In Vivo team and drive the characterization and development of small molecules biologics radioligands antibody-drug conjugates and cell therapies for the treatment of cancer. We execute in vivo pharmacology studies within Oncology research programs to meet departmental drug development and strategic objectives to bring life-changing therapies to the clinic! We characterize potential clinical therapeutics through the evaluation of target inhibition efficacy mechanism of action pharmacokinetic/pharmacodynamics (PK/PD) and biomarker evaluations.

In this role you will lead other leaders and individual contributors within a collaborative team interacting with discovery leaders and cross-functional project teams. You will be accountable for effective performance management and meaningful career development conversations. Your leadership responsibilities include the design execution and interpretation of in vivo studies for the validation and characterization of targets or therapeutic agents in the areas of oncology and tumor immunology. Additionally you will provide input to operational plans with measurable contribution towards the achievement of short-term department results.

Qualifications/ Requirements:

Education:

  • Bachelors degree (BS/ BA) in the life sciences (molecular/ cellular biology biochemistry pharmacology tumor immunology) with at least 15 years pharmaceutical or biotech industry/ lab/ academic experience OR a Masters degree (MS) with at least 12 years experience or PhD with 5-8 years of relevant post-graduate experience.

Experience and Skills:

Required:

  • Expertise in drug development of Oncology therapeutics.
  • Experience in optimally leading individuals and/or teams.
  • Experience with oncology-relevant rodent models such as xenografts and syngeneic models orthotopic models humanized models or genetically engineered tumor models.
  • Expertise in study design data analysis interpretation and presentation of in vivo pharmacology studies.
  • Strong organizational skills including the ability to handle several projects simultaneously; detail oriented with excellent record keeping skills.
  • Excellent communication skills including effective interaction with people and teams both internally and externally.
  • Presentation of scientific data and concepts to colleagues and teams.
  • Proven record of adherence to animal welfare and compliance regulations.

Preferred:

  • Experience in writing technical drafts for patent filings IND (US-FDA) or CTA (EMA) filings.
